Market Overview

The global investment casting market size was valued at USD 15.29 billion in 2021 and is projected to reach USD 24.73 billion by 2030, registering a CAGR of 5.49% from 2022 to 2030.

The process known as investment casting involves producing a metal component with the use of an investment mold throughout the production stage. The investment casting process is also known as the Lost wax method. This approach is helpful in the process that will follow, which includes reducing the amount of material waste, energy consumption, and machining. The aerospace, gas turbine, industrial, and automotive industries are where their principal applications can be found.

The ability of investment casting to maintain a close dimensional structure while also producing a smooth surface is the primary factor propelling the market's expansion. Its extensive use in the fabrication of components used in aircraft as well as parts of machines used in industries has also been a contributor to the expansion, along with several other variables that have been responsible for the rise. Complex geometries and materials from more advanced forms of engineering are required for the various components that go into the design of aircraft.

Demand has increased for a variety of components, including air ducts, complex curved surfaces, engine chambers, and internal channels. During the manufacturing process of airplanes, the utilization of investment casting permits the development of structures that are not only lightweight but also highly constructed. According to the findings of the surveys, it is anticipated that the aerospace industry will have significant expansion in the years to come, which will lead to advancements in the investment casting business.

Market Dynamics

Market Drivers

  • Growing aerospace & military industry

The expanding aerospace and military industries are major drivers of the demand for investment casting. This is because investment casting is used to produce a wide variety of applications and parts for aircraft, helicopters, and jets. Investment casting is also used to produce a variety of other parts and applications. These include flight critical and safety components, components for landing and braking, and components for the hydraulic fluid system; all of these are essential to ensuring the aircraft's continued operational viability.

Aerospace and defense became the most important market sector in the United States in 2021, accounting for a revenue share that was greater than 62.0 percent. Key participants in the aerospace sector are opening new plants to meet the growing demand for satellites as well as commercial and private jets. These new plants will be able to produce more of the goods that are in demand. For example, the Swedish company Saab AB plans to establish a new aircraft plant in West Lafayette, Indiana, in October of 2021.

Market Restraints

  • High manufacturing costs & energy consumption

The demand for investment castings is being held back by a few problems, such as the high cost of production and the extensive amount of energy it requires. However, foundries are working together to develop innovative advanced casting technologies through the use of simulations in an effort to overcome these problems. If successful, this will likely decrease the amount of time spent on the shop floor and boost the casting yield.

Market Opportunity

  • Various technological advancement

X-ray defect detection, all-in-one 3D printing, casting and forging techniques, and other technological advancements are all contributing to the creation of new opportunities for business expansion. Improvements in casting processes can be achieved through computer simulations and the implementation of metal additive manufacturing practices. These procedures contribute to the manufacture of products that are cost-effective as well as stable and structurally durable. It is projected that other factors, such as speedy industrialization and substantial research and development (R&D) efforts, would generate chances for the market in the future.

Segmental Analysis

In 2021, aerospace & defense accounted for around 46.0% of the global market's revenue. The aircraft sector relies heavily on investment cast components for a variety of important applications. Investment casting is used to produce highly engineered castings such as cable clamps, ball bearings, fuel valves, gasoline manifold, landing gear, brake systems, pitot probes, and other sensors.

The mechanical engineering business is one of the leading suppliers of capital goods and is in high demand. It is projected that a quick increase in production activities will augment industry expansion, consequently increasing demand for investment castings over the projection period. Using investment casting techniques, agricultural equipment with excellent durability and long-life cycles for tough agricultural applications is created.

During the projected period, the rising need for shale gas is anticipated to increase the demand for investment cast components even further. For land and offshore drilling activities, in addition to hydraulic fracturing applications, highly designed cast items are utilized. In addition, investment castings are used to produce compressor components, impellers, valve components, flanges, electrical equipment & fittings, connections, and housings for the oil & gas industry.

Regional Analysis

The market is split by region into North America, Europe, Asia-Pacific, and LAMEA.

In 2021, the Asia Pacific region was the most important part of the worldwide market. This region accounted for more than 35.0 percent of the revenue share. The demand in the region is primarily driven by the consistently strong expansion of the manufacturing sectors of the automotive, aerospace, and industrial machinery industries. Because there are so many small- and medium-sized factories in the area, investment cast items are produced in greater quantity here than anywhere else in the world.

Over 1,500 foundries in China make components for the automotive and aerospace industries, making the country the leading producer of investment casting components in the Asia Pacific region. Given the availability of foundries for automotive turbochargers, gas turbines, and biomedical applications, Japan is one of the emerging producers of investment cast parts. On the other hand, South Korea demonstrates an increased product demand in the automotive industry.

Over the course of the projected period, it is anticipated that Europe would expand at a compound annual growth rate of 4.4 percent. The region has seen a growth in the use of new generation alloys in aviation components due to the capacity of these alloys to endure high temperatures. This is anticipated to lead to an increase in the usage of these alloys in both commercial and military types of aircraft. The demand for investment casting in Europe's aerospace sector is anticipated to be driven throughout the forecast period by rising technological penetration in the production of high-performance alloy parts.

In 2021, North America was the most dominant region in the market and accounted for the biggest revenue share, which was greater than 36.0 percent. This is because investment casting is so widely utilized in the production of high-value-added components for a wide variety of industries, including the aerospace and defense, oil and gas, and medical industries.
